Dec. 31, 2007 - Worthington Area - 2007 home sales

There were 404 single family home sales closed in Worthington area (Worthington School district but not located in the city of Worthington or Riverlea ) in 2007.  These homes are in the city of Columbus or Perry or Sharon Township.  These homes are all in the Worthington School District.  The Worthington School District extends to the northern tip of Franklin County along routes 315 and state route 23 (High Street) and east to Interstate 71.   West of the Olentangy River, the school boundaries are more irregular.

2007 Worthington Area Single Family Home Sales:


List Prices ranged from $59,300 (really! a house in Mt. Air) to $675,000.

Closed Sales Prices ranged from $54,000  to $655,000.


The average closed real estate sales price for single family homes in $217,881.


On average, these homes sold for 97 % of their final list price.


Days on Market ranged from 1 to 632 days, with the average being 93 *days of market time.


This compares to 460 single family homes closed in 2006, with an average closed sales price of $229,469.

And

This compares to 546 single family homes closed in 2005, with an average closed sales price of $220,487.


The homes sold in 2007 were in neighborhoods in the city of Columbus and Perry and Sharon Townships including Worthington Hills, Maple Hill Retreat, Stilson Highlands, Bluffview, Olentangy Highlands, Olde Sawmille, Brookside Estates, Worthingtview,  Brookside Village, Worthington Highlands, Worthington Trace, Westworth Village, The Sanctuary, Lindsey Woods, Woods at the Joesphinum, Ravens Glen and others.

Dec. 31, 2007 - Powell - 2007 Home Sales

There were 153 single family home sales closed in Powell in 2007.  Powell is a suburb of Columbus in southern Delaware County.  

2007 Powell Single Family Home Sales:

List Prices ranged from $85,900 (yes!) to $695,850.

Closed Sales Prices ranged from $79,900 to $675,000.


The average closed real estate sales price for single family homes in Powell was $371,983


On average, these homes sold for 96.9% of their final list price. 
 

Days on Market ranged from 1 to 712  days, with the average being 125* days of market time.


Average Sales Price per square foot was $ 122.24



This compares to 177 single family homes closed in 2006, with an average closed sales price of $365,794.

AND

This compares to 183 single family homes closed in 2005, with an average closed sales price of $356,280. 

The 2007 homes sales in Powell were in neighborhoods including:

Golf Village Estates, Chambers Glen, Deer Run, Golf Village, Rutherford Estates, Woods of Sawmill, Liberty Hills, Falcon Ridge, Grandshire, Olentangy Ridge, Lakes of Powell, Murphy's Park and Old Powell

Dec. 31, 2007 - Worthington - 2007 Home Sales

There were 217 single family home sales closed in the City of Worthington (and Riverlea) in 2007. 

Worthington and Riverleal are suburbs of Columbus inside of 270.    Riverlea which is on the Olentangy River is surrounded by Worthington on the other three sides.  The MLS (the multiple listing service of the Columbus Board of Realtors) combines the City of Worthington and Riverlea into one MLS area.

2007 Single Family Home Sales in Worthington:

List Prices ranged from $117,500  to  $899,900.
Closed Sales Prices ranged from $120,000  to  $885,000.

The average closed real estate sales price for single family homes in $263,499.


On average, these homes sold for 96.3 % of their final list price.  
 
Average Sale Price / SqFt = $ 133.69

Days on Market ranged from 1 to 423  days, with the average being 84 days of market time.


This compares to 192 single family homes closed in 2006, with an average closed sales price of $245,899.

AND

This compares to 214  single family homes closed in 2005, with an average closed sales price of $239,085.
 
The homes sold in 2007 in the City of Wortington (and Riverlea)  included homes in neighborhoods including:  Medick Estates, Estates at Olentangy, Medick Estates, Old Worthington , Bristol Woods, Plesenton  Place,  Old Worthington, Olentangy Hills, Worthingway, Worthington Estates, Shaker Square, Colonial Hills, Wilson Hills and other neighbrohoods.
